138.10 JUDICIAL REVIEW.
Judicial review of actions of the director may be sought in
accordance with the terms of the Iowa administrative procedure Act,
chapter 17A. Notwithstanding the terms of said Act, petitions for
judicial review may be filed in the district court of the county
wherein the license was to be issued or wherein such license is to be
revoked or suspended, and such a petition for judicial review shall
not operate to stay any order or final determination of the director
unless the district court finds upon hearing after reasonable notice
to all interested parties, that substantial damage would result to
the appealing party unless such order or final determination was
stayed and such a stay would not endanger the health, safety, or
welfare of any inhabitants of a migrant labor camp.
